  • La Roche-Posay MELA-D SERUM
    8.0

    La Roche-Posay MELA-D SERUM

    seems to be working

    i've been using mela d for about 2 years now. i have hyperpigmentation on my face and this seems to be breaking it up. it doesn't work if you continue to be exposed to the sun. also, you really must combine this with the use of a sunscreen or any gains will be lost. even when i use 30+ SPF, if i'm out in the sun the hyperpigmentation comes back. as i said, this seems to be doing the trick. but i will continue to experiment with other treatments for brown spots.

  • Aveda Beautifying Composition
    9.0

    Aveda Beautifying Composition

    sking your regular skin routine.

    i use this oil as a rich facial treatment. i apply it on my entire face (including eye lids) at room temperature after washing and toning. i do not rinse and i do not wipe it off. i usually do this at night, before bed, on days when i'm too lazy to do my whole routine. these oils do not block pores or cause breakouts. the label says "for body, bath and scalp." but i use it exclusively on my face and neck. just shake several drops into your palm, dab your fingers into it, and massage into your skin.
